Phu Quoc National Park is a protected area that occupies a substantial portion of Phu Quoc Island and nearby islets in southwestern Vietnam. It conserves tropical forest, coastal habitats, and surrounding marine areas important for biodiversity.

Visitors use the park for rainforest hiking, wildlife viewing, and access to quieter beaches and nearshore reefs for snorkeling or diving; trails and natural viewpoints offer inland perspectives while boats serve coastal sites. The park is an important destination for nature-based tourism on the island.

The park was established by the Vietnamese government to protect the island’s ecosystems and to manage both terrestrial and marine resources. Management combines conservation goals with regulated visitor access to sensitive habitats.

Located on Phu Quoc Island in Kien Giang province, the park covers large tracts of the island’s interior and northern reaches; the main access points are near the island’s population centers and ports, including the town of Duong Dong.

How to Get to Phu Quoc National Park #

Phu Quoc National Park is on Phu Quoc Island. The island has an international airport (Phu Quoc International Airport) with flights from Ho Chi Minh City and other regional hubs. From the airport or main towns, local roads and taxis connect to park entrances; some trails begin near Duong Dong and extend inland.

Tips for Visiting Phu Quoc National Park #

  • Hire a local guide for longer treks-forest trails can be poorly signed and guides support local conservation economies.
  • Visit early in the morning to see active wildlife and to experience quieter forest trails.

Best Time to Visit Phu Quoc National Park #

November-April is the most comfortable season with lower rain and calmer seas; ideal for combining rainforest treks with coastal activities.

Dry season
November-April · 24-31°C (75-88°F)
Drier seas and calmer weather-best for hiking and beach visits on the island.
Wet season
May-October · 25-33°C (77-91°F)
Hotter and humid with heavy rains; some trails may be muddy and sea conditions rough.

Weather & Climate near Phu Quoc National Park #

Climate

Phu Quoc National Park's climate is classified as Tropical Monsoon - Tropical Monsoon climate with consistently warm temperatures year-round. Temperatures range from 22°C to 33°C. Heavy rainfall (3480 mm/year), wettest in July with a pronounced dry season.
